Mae Gene, the daughter of Mr. and Mrs. Newton Childs, who live a quarter of a mile east of here on the High Street road, died this morning at nine o'clock. She had been ill for the last six weeks with intestinal trouble, but her condition was not thought serious until last Wednesday. This morning the child seemed much better but she suddenly became worse and died within a few minutes. She was the youngest of nine children, another baby having died when only a few weeks old, and was born May the eighth, 1917.

The funeral will be held at the family home Thursday morning at ten o'clock, and the body will be laid to rest at the Cana, Jennings county, cemetery. Seymour Democrat
